Re: acroread



 Jerry Feldman wrote: 
> Apparently whenever you access a PDF through a browser, 
> acroread.exe remains in the process table. 

I ran into that years ago and reconfigured my browsers to view PDFs 
external to the browser. Then when Foxit Reader[1] became available, I 
switched to that. It's far less resource intensive, and doesn't have all 
the intrusive features that the Adobe reader has. 

Now uninstalling Acrobat and replacing it with Foxit Reader is standard 
procedure whenever I set up a Windows box.
